The “secret ingredient” they’re referring to is salt.
🧂 Why do people add salt to mop water?
Some popular home-cleaning beliefs claim that salt can:
-
Help lift dirt
-
Reduce bacteria (mildly)
-
Prevent ants or insects
-
Leave floors looking cleaner longer
However…
⚠️ Does it actually work?
Salt does have mild abrasive and antimicrobial properties, but:
-
It’s not a disinfectant
-
It won’t keep floors clean for a whole week
-
It can leave residue if too much is used
-
It may damage certain surfaces (like natural stone)
